Tómas is well known for his versatile and strong stage presence, combined with a rich and powerful voice. He made his role debut as Sparafucile in Verdi’s Rigoletto at the age of 24 and furthered his studies at the Reykjavik College of Music and at the Royal College of Music in London, where he graduated with distinction. His vast repertoire ranges from Monteverdi, Verdi and Puccini, Wagner and Richard Strauss, Tchaikovsky, Mussorgsky and Prokofiev to Zemlinsky, Korngold and Janáček, Glass, Reimann and Eötvös.He made his role debut in the Heldenbariton repertoire as Count Tomski/The Queen of Spades at Théâtre de la Monnaie in Brussels, followed by the title roles of Der fliegende Holländer (also at Théâtre de la Monnaie) and Wozzeck at Opéra National de Lorraine Nancy.

Throughout his career, Tómas has taken on a wide range of repertoire, from Barock and Classical, through Romantic to Modern; lately some of the great roles in Richard Wagner’s and Richard Strauss’s operas, as well as a selective few Modern and Contemporary works, including the World Premieres of La Bianca Notte by Bear Furrer conducted by Simone Young at the Hamburg State Opera, Sleepless by Peter Eötvös conducted by the composer and Maxime Pascal at the Berlin State Opera Unter den Linden and Antigone by Pascal Dusapin conducted by Klaus Mäkelä at the Philharmonie de Paris.

There are a few roles Tómas has performed in numerous venues and have become like friends he revisits regularly; the title role in Richard Wagners Der fliegende Holländer in Brussels, Barcelona, Los Angeles, Dresden, Lisbon, Torino and Bari; Klingsor in Parsifal in Brussels, Chicago, Budapest and Berlin; Wotan/Wanderer in the Ring cycle in Oviedo, Geneva and Naples; Friedrich von Telramund in Lohengrin in Bayreuth, Wiesbaden, Bonn, São Paulo, Milan, Kaoshiung and Rome; Kurwenal in Tristan und Isolde in Barcelona, Bari and Warsaw; Amfortas in Parsifal in Budapest and Palermo; Alberich in Wagners Ring Cycle in Dallas, Beijing and Hangzhou; Jochanaan in Richard Strauss’ Salome in Thessaloniki, Berlin, Dresden, Los Angeles, Tokyo and Dublin; the title role in Aribert Reimanns Lear in Berlin, Frankfurt, Budapest, München, Hannover and Prague; Count Tomski in Tchaikovskys Queen of Spades in Brussels, Cardiff, San Francisco, Houston, Naples, Antwerp/Ghent and Vienna.

Roles which would be a welcome addition to this list are Hans Sachs in Wagners Die Meistersinger von Nürnberg, which he performed at the Komische Oper Berlin and jumped in to save a performance in Wiesbaden, and Scarpia in Giacomo Puccini’s Tosca, which he performed in Dublin with Irish National Opera.

Tómas has performed at many renowned houses such as the Royal Opera House Covent Garden, Teatro alla Scala, Vienna State Opera, Bavarian State Opera Munich, Dresden Semperoper, Staatsoper Unter den Linden Berlin, Komische Oper Berlin, State Opera Hamburg, Opera Cologne, Teatro dell’Opera di Roma, Teatro Regio Turin, Teatro San Carlo Naples, Teatro Real de Madrid, Théâtre de la Monnaie Brussels, Grand Théâtre de Genève, Nederlandse Opera Amsterdam, Hungarian State Opera Budapest, Royal Danish Opera Copenhagen, Lyric Opera Chicago, Los Angeles Opera, San Francisco Opera and Washington National Opera.

He collaborated with conductors such as Riccardo Muti, Daniel Barenboim, Antonio Pappano, Andris Nelsons, Simone Young, René Jacobs, Stefan Soltesz, Hartmut Haenchen, Mark Elder, Carlo Rizzi, James Conlon, Juraj Valčuha, Ingo Metzmacher, Jakub Hrůša, Constantin Trinks, Lorin Maazel, Semyon Bychkov, Jukka-Pekka Saraste and Klaus Mäkelä.

Among the stage-directors Tómas worked with are Hans Neuenfels, Claus Guth, Keith Warner, Dmitri Tcherniakov, Kornél Mundruczó, Richard Jones, Andreas Homoki, Guy Joosten, Günter Krämer, Dieter Dorn, Robert Carsen, Graham Vick and John Copley.

On the concert stage he sang Verdi’s Requiem, J.S. Bach’s St Matthew Passion, Mozart’s Requiem, Haydn’s The Creation, Beethoven’s Symphony No 9, as well as Mahler’s Symphony No 8.
